Team 384 Presents Sparky XV

Team 384's 15th anniversary submission is Sparky XV

Details:
6 Wheel Drive with 4" Performance Wheels and 3D printed wheels
6 CIM gearbox at 15 fps
Catapult powered by constant force springs
Roller intake with two 4" 3D printed wheels
Removable drive modules on each side

Quote:
Originally Posted by lukedude43 View Post
Any chance you have a part number for the constant force spring, also how many did you use?
We are using four 41 lb springs. We get them from McMaster-Carr, part number 9293K14.
